Zebra VIQF-IOT-PILOT VisibilityIQ Foresight IoT Pilot Program
The Zebra VIQF-IOT-PILOT is a 90-day pilot offering from Zebra that enables organizations to evaluate the VisibilityIQ Foresight platform for Internet of Things (IoT) asset visibility and management. This pilot program is designed for enterprise customers seeking to assess real-time asset tracking, device management, and operational intelligence capabilities across their distributed infrastructure before committing to full deployment.
Program Overview
The VIQF-IOT-PILOT provides access to Zebra's VisibilityIQ Foresight IoT platform during an initial 90-day evaluation window. Organizations can deploy and test the platform's core functionality, connectivity layers, and integration points with existing enterprise systems. This pilot structure allows IT managers, security integrators, and telecom buyers to validate architectural fit, assess performance under real-world operating conditions, and determine scaling requirements before production rollout.

Deployment Considerations:
- Plan pilot deployment scope carefully — define which asset categories, network segments, or geographic areas will participate to generate representative data.
- Establish baseline metrics early in the pilot so you can clearly measure platform performance and ROI impact before production rollout.
- Document integration requirements and API endpoints during the pilot to accelerate production deployment timelines.
